**Mgmt Meeting Minutes — Retiring the Brightline Range**

Quick recap for sales leads at Fenholt Supplies: we agreed to retire the Brightline fixture range by year-end. Remaining stock moves to clearance pricing next month, and accounts on standing orders get migrated to the Lumetta range. Trade-in incentives were approved in principle. The confidential note on next steps sits just below.

board note of bajof-bajeg: The pricing group signed off on a budget of $13.4 million for Project Sildor. The renewal with Lamixek Holdings closes at $48.9 million a year, 49 percent above the last contract.

Ticket: roof-terrace door, Marlow Exchange building. The door from the Level 6 landing onto the terrace keeps jamming — you have to shoulder it pretty hard, and twice this week contractors got stuck out there in the cold. Looks like the frame has swollen or the closer's overtightened. Can someone from the Hollis crew take a look this week? Until it's fixed, contractors should use the east stair door instead, which is on a keypad. That code is below.

turnstile pass: bdg-YPPQB-52010

The reseller programme is finally getting teeth. Next quarter we're onboarding eight partners across the Calderstone region, each with certified training on the Mirewell suite before they can transact. Margins: 20% standard, 25% for partners hitting two deals a quarter. Direct deals still take priority on conflicts — register everything early to avoid channel fights. Keava's team owns partner enablement; route questions there. Targets go into your dashboards Friday. One more thing, kept quiet for now.

management briefing: Only 14 of the 251 pilot accounts renewed Queniel, so a churn review is set for April 11. Keloxox Foods is in early talks to buy Lamathix Freight for about $358.4 million.

## Step 4: Enable batched resolvers

The Grelfind API previously fired one query per author node, causing N+1 blowups on large feeds. Migrate to the dataloader layer in `resolvers/batch.gql.js` and delete the legacy per-node fetchers. Verify query count drops in the trace dashboard. Apply the following resolver settings exactly as shown below.

config for kadup-kawig:
[ulaeth]
team = sorvan
access_code = ac_b01674
owner = jorir.briwyn
host = ulaeth.zarqelstack.local
port = 9000
peer = pelmir.lumicdyn.local
salt = e48c0bfe
pin = 5496